India, July 26 -- Vaibhav Sooryavanshi has well and truly arrived in international cricket. The left-handed batter on Sunday won the Player of the Match and Player of the Series accolades for the first time for India. The left-handed batter returned with an 81-run knock, and this innings set up the win for the visitors, helping Shreyas Iyer and co whitewash Zimbabwe in the three-match series. After winning both big accolades, Sooryavanshi kept it real, saying it all feels like a dream-come-true moment for him. He also added that it always feels special to contribute to the team's cause.
